# Break-Glass: Catalog Cache Invalidation

Scope: the Pinrow product catalog at Veldstone Retail. If stale prices persist after a purge and the Hollowmere invalidation queue is wedged, use break-glass to flush the edge tier directly. Contractors: get verbal sign-off from the catalog lead first. Steps: open the Hollowmere admin shell, select emergency-flush, confirm the tenant, and run it once — repeated flushes thrash the origin. Access is logged and expires after 20 minutes. Unseal the admin shell with the passphrase below.

recovery phrase for kahop-tajog: istix-casvan

## Authentication

Quick heads-up for new folks: the Crumbline API enforces our order-cutoff rule (no new bakery orders after 15:00 for next-day pickup), and it won't even talk to you without a valid internal key. The key goes in your local env file — never commit it, seriously. Grab the dev instance key below and you're good to start poking at the cutoff endpoints.

gateway credential: kto23_LX9A4ys6i4nzHtpOLNLodKK

## Local setup

Heads up, plugin authors: the Grainfall spreadsheet exporter is memory-hungry. Exporting anything over ~50k rows locally will happily eat 2 GB, so bump your container limit before blaming your plugin. We're moving to streamed writes in a future release, promise. Run the bootstrap script, then seed the sample workbook data. The seeder needs a local database, which it reaches through the connection string below.

primary connection of yagep-kahip = redis://giliel_svc:zYiKsLL2PLpfPL@db-348f.xolmarsys.corp:5432/fenwyn

Subject: Cut-over complete — Harridge pinning policy

Cut-over to exact-version pinning finished last night. All Novaform services now build from the locked manifest; floating ranges are rejected at CI. No incidents during the switch. Security review item: please confirm the resolver flags match policy. The enforced settings are listed below.

deployment values, yadug-bawif:
[framir]
team = pelox
access_code = ac_a38ab2
owner = tamion.julael
host = framir.tolvaqlabs.test
port = 11211
peer = tammir.zemvargrid.local
salt = 2215ef03
pin = 1541